### Partner SFTP Drop — Harlowe Feeds

New engineers: the Harlowe partner uploads nightly inventory files to our SFTP drop around 01:30. The intake daemon, Ferrybox, polls every ten minutes, validates checksums, and quarantines malformed files for manual review. Please flag repeated quarantines at the weekly sync rather than deleting them. Ferrybox records ingestion status in the feeds database, which it reaches via the connection string below.

replica DSN, kajep-yahag: mssql://praok_svc:iF@db-8d68.plorvaio.local:5432/eliion

- [ ] Step 7: Archive cold storage buckets (Glacierline tier). Confirm both ceremony witnesses are present, verify bucket manifests match the Oxbow ledger, then seal the archive key shares. Plugin authors may observe but not handle shares. Once sealed, the archive index itself is encrypted and can only be reopened with the passphrase below.

vault phrase of badup-hahig = tamael-aldael-kelmir-istael-fenok-istwyn-tamius-jorath-oliion

Finance Review Summary — Supplier Contract Renewal

For heads of department: the renewal with Tarnbeck Components has been assessed. Proposed terms raise unit cost 3 percent but lock pricing for two years and add penalty clauses for late delivery. Alternatives from Orvale Supply were costlier on a total-basis view. Finance recommends renewal, subject to legal sign-off expected this month. Cash-flow impact is modest and already reflected in the forecast. The confidential note on business plans appears immediately below.

board note of bajop-yaweg: The western region missed its Pelys quota by 58.0 percent last quarter. Pelysek Foods plans to raise the Belius list price by 44.0 percent in July. The steering committee signed off on a budget of $133.8 million for Project Pelax. The renewal with Zoraelix Systems closes at $61.9 million a year, 12.7 percent above the last contract.